[wordpress/f18] New upstream release.

Matej Cepl mcepl at fedoraproject.org
Wed Dec 12 13:12:39 UTC 2012


commit 5faa94e8f3ed4362d2248f5a357bd16ba6cb4bd0
Author: Matěj Cepl <mcepl at redhat.com>
Date:   Sun Sep 16 17:12:56 2012 +0200

    New upstream release.
    
    Also:
     * use system PHPMailer
     * requires needed php extensions

 .gitignore     |   30 +--------------------------
 sources        |    2 +-
 wordpress.spec |   61 +++++++++++++++++++++++++++++++++++++++++++++++--------
 3 files changed, 54 insertions(+), 39 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index f4e7ed0..4f114c6 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,29 +1 @@
-wordpress-3.0.1.tar.gz
-/wordpress-3.0.2.tar.gz
-/wordpress-3.0.3.tar.gz
-/wordpress-3.0.4.tar.gz
-/wordpress-3.1.tar.gz
-/wordpress-3.1.1.tar.gz
-/wordpress-3.1.2.tar.gz
-/wordpress-3.1.3.tar.gz
-/wordpress-3.2-RC1.zip
-/wordpress-3.2-RC3.zip
-/wordpress-3.2.tar.gz
-/wordpress-3.2.1.tar.gz
-/wordpress-3.3-beta2.tar.gz
-/wordpress-3.3-beta3.tar.gz
-/wordpress-3.3-beta4.tar.gz
-/wordpress-3.3-RC1.tar.gz
-/wordpress-3.3-RC2.tar.gz
-/wordpress-3.3.tar.gz
-/wordpress-3.3.1.tar.gz
-/wordpress-3.4-beta1.tar.gz
-/wordpress-3.4-beta2.tar.gz
-/wordpress-3.4-beta3.tar.gz
-/wordpress-3.4-beta4.tar.gz
-/wordpress-3.4-RC1.tar.gz
-/wordpress-3.4-RC2.tar.gz
-/wordpress-3.4-RC3.tar.gz
-/wordpress-3.4.tar.gz
-/wordpress-3.4.1.tar.gz
-/wordpress-3.4.2.tar.gz
+/wordpress-3.5.tar.gz
diff --git a/sources b/sources
index 4697198..3744939 100644
--- a/sources
+++ b/sources
@@ -1 +1 @@
-dfc56cee27eec8fb79070f033ecd4b25  wordpress-3.4.2.tar.gz
+105b5baff67344528bb5d8b71c050b0d  wordpress-3.5.tar.gz
diff --git a/wordpress.spec b/wordpress.spec
index 414d616..c17dc8c 100644
--- a/wordpress.spec
+++ b/wordpress.spec
@@ -1,15 +1,16 @@
 %global wp_content %{_datadir}/wordpress/wp-content
-#%#global betatag -RC3
+%global betatag RC3
 
 Summary: Blog tool and publishing platform
 URL: http://www.wordpress.org
 Name: wordpress
-Version: 3.4.2
+Version: 3.5
 Group: Applications/Publishing
-#Release: 0.2.%{betatag}%{?dist}
-Release: 2%{?dist}
+#Release: 0.5.%{betatag}%{?dist}
+Release: 1%{?dist}
 License: GPLv2
-Source0: http://wordpress.org/%{name}-%{version}%{?betatag}.tar.gz
+#Source0: http://wordpress.org/%{name}-%{version}-%{betatag}.tar.gz
+Source0: http://wordpress.org/%{name}-%{version}.tar.gz
 Source1: wordpress-httpd-conf
 Source2: README.fedora.wordpress
 Source3: README.fedora.wordpress-mu
@@ -19,7 +20,41 @@ Patch0: wordpress-debian_patches_hello.patch
 # Move wp-content to /var/www/wordpress/
 Patch1: wordpress-move-wp-content.patch
 B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
-Requires: php >= 5.2.4, webserver, php-mysql, php-gettext, php-simplepie
+%if 0%{?rhel} == 5
+Requires: php53 >= 5.2.4, php53-simplepie
+%else
+Requires: php >= 5.2.4, php-simplepie
+%endif
+# Required php extension (detected by phpci)
+Requires: php-curl
+Requires: php-date
+Requires: php-dom
+Requires: php-enchant
+# not yet available for RHEL Requires: php-ereg
+Requires: php-exif
+Requires: php-fileinfo
+# not yet available for RHEL Requires: php-filter
+Requires: php-gettext
+Requires: php-hash
+Requires: php-iconv
+Requires: php-json
+Requires: php-libxml
+Requires: php-mbstring
+Requires: php-mysql
+Requires: php-openssl
+Requires: php-pcre
+Requires: php-pdo
+Requires: php-posix
+Requires: php-reflection
+Requires: php-simplexml
+Requires: php-sockets
+Requires: php-spl
+Requires: php-tokenizer
+Requires: php-zip
+Requires: php-zlib
+# Unbundled libraries
+Requires: php-PHPMailer
+Requires: webserver
 Provides: wordpress-mu = %{version}-%{release}
 Obsoletes: wordpress-mu < 2.9.3
 BuildArch: noarch
@@ -65,13 +100,14 @@ find ${RPM_BUILD_ROOT} -type f -empty -exec rm -vf {} \;
 # These are docs, remove them from here, docify them later
 rm -f ${RPM_BUILD_ROOT}%{_datadir}/wordpress/{license.txt,readme.html}
 
-# Remove bundled php-gettext and link to system copy
-rm -f ${RPM_BUILD_ROOT}%{_datadir}/wordpress/wp-includes/gettext.php
-
 # Remove bundled php-simplepie and link to system copy
 rm -f ${RPM_BUILD_ROOT}%{_datadir}/wordpress/wp-includes/class-simplepie.php
 ln -sf /usr/share/php/php-simplepie/simplepie.inc ${RPM_BUILD_ROOT}%{_datadir}/wordpress/wp-includes/class-simplepie.php
 
+# Remove bundled PHPMailer and link to system one
+rm -f ${RPM_BUILD_ROOT}%{_datadir}/wordpress/wp-includes/class-{phpmailer,smtp,pop3}.php
+ln -sf /usr/share/php/PHPMailer/*php ${RPM_BUILD_ROOT}%{_datadir}/wordpress/wp-includes/
+
 # Remove backup copies of patches
 find ${RPM_BUILD_ROOT} \( -name \*.dolly -o -name \*.rhbz522897 -o -name \*.FSFaddr \) \
     -print -delete
@@ -117,6 +153,13 @@ rm -rf ${RPM_BUILD_ROOT}
 %dir %{_sysconfdir}/wordpress
 
 %changelog
+* Wed Dec 12 2012 Matěj Cepl <mcepl at redhat.com> - 3.5-1
+- New upstream release.
+
+* Mon Oct 29 2012 Remi Collet <rcollet at redhat.com> - 3.5-0.3.beta2
+- use system PHPMailer
+- requires needed php extensions
+
 * Thu Sep 06 2012 Matej Cepl <mcepl at redhat.com> - 3.4.2-2
 - Upstream security update.
 


More information about the scm-commits mailing list